200如何与串口通信

就是用S7——200与串口助手通讯,互相发数据,两边的数据地址如何对应的?给详细点步骤,谢谢!!!

最佳答案

用XMT/RCV指令
 200PLC和电脑用PPI电缆连接,关闭200编程软件。200和串口软件通讯不需要地址,一般串口软件是什么数据都收。
 1 PLC给串口软件发数据,可用下面程序
 数据块:
 vb101 25
 vb102 26
 vb103 27
 vb104 28
 vb105 29

 程序块:
 网络1
 LD     SM0.1
 MOVB   9, SMB30
 MOVB   5, VB100
 网络2
 LD     SM4.5
 XMT    VB100, 0

 串口软件设置为:无校验,每个字符8个数据位,波特率9600,设置正确的端口号
 这样串口软件就可以收到25 26 27 28 29 ,而且能收到很多。

 2 用串口软件给PLC发数据 ,串口软件设置同上,代码如下
 网络1
 LD     SM0.1
 MOVB   9, SMB30
 MOVB   156, SMB87
 MOVW   0, SMW90
 MOVW   200, SMW92
 MOVB   200, SMB94
 网络2
 LDB<>  SMB86, 0
 RCV    VB0, 0

 串口软件给PLC发的数据可在VB1开始的表里查看,如果发10个字节的数据,那么数据放在VB1-VB10里,
 如果发100个字节的数据,那么数据在VB1-VB100里,可以在状态图里查看。

提问者对于答案的评价:
xiexie

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c354019.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日
下一篇 2021年7月5日

相关推荐

  • 重启电源dip有效

    听他们说em235模拟模块的dip开关设置后,要重新开一下电源,设置才有效,这是为什么呢?? 最佳答案 内部CPU启动时会读DIP的开关位置,作为一个内部的处理参数。之后就不再读取…

    SIMATIC S7-200 2020年11月1日
  • s7200密码

    由于我i原来PLC程序上载和在线下载都设置了密码,很久没有用过了,密码忘记了,我选择 PLC > 清除(clear)菜单命令,会不会把我原来S7…

    SIMATIC S7-200 2021年7月4日
  • 西门子200中,怎么看程序结构

    就是在西门子200的程序中,我想知道各个子程序之间的调用情况,300的step7中有,但是200的我不知道 最佳答案 编辑—查找,输入子程序名即可。 提问者对于答案的评价:只能这么…

    SIMATIC S7-200 2021年7月5日
  • PID控制案例谁有?

    3个同步油缸、通过油缸里移位传感器控制3个比例阀4-20mA  ,谁做过给发一份。谢谢!  问题补充:S7-200的PID资料谁能给发一份 最佳答案 …

    SIMATIC S7-200 2021年7月4日
  • s7-200的sp4版无法删除

    我安装s7-200的软件,要求先把sp4版删除,再安装sp6版。但是现在sp4版怎样也删除不了,从注册表上都删除不了,怎么办呢?向下没法进行了 最佳答案 下载一个SP6的完整安装包…

    SIMATIC S7-200 2021年7月4日
  • 可以进行写操作的Modubus测试软件

    要做一个项目用200PLC做modbus的从站,现在我想用测试软件自己先模拟一下,但是modscan32好象只能读取我PLC的数据,不能发送.请问有没有可以通过modbus发送到P…

    SIMATIC S7-200 2020年11月1日
  • 关于EM235电流输出端不接负载有电流输出

    西门子235的电流输出端IO什么不接负载直接用万用表量会有电流?好像没有回路啊。请大神们赐教,五一愉快! 最佳答案 五一快乐!这个测试需要让模块连接到24V电压,见附件。然后编辑一…

    2017年10月29日
  • smart 200plc 画圆弧

    用SMART200(好像是ST40,反正就是可以控制两个轴的)的PLC控制两个步进电机画圆弧、画圆(不用上位机就用PLC写程序),希望给个思路或用到什么指令(最好讲详细点,谢谢。)…

    SIMATIC S7-200 2017年6月1日
  • 请教大神们200PLC和Virtual Box虚拟机的通信?急急急!

    我的宿机系统是WIN10专业版,装了个Virtual Box虚拟机,并在里面装了XP SP3系统,然后用PC Adapter USB&nbs…

    2017年6月2日
  • s7-200PLC与装有AB组态软件的PC连接通讯问题

    S7-200PLC通过profibus dp EM277模块与AB的组态软件Factroy Talk view studio&nb…

    SIMATIC S7-200 2020年10月31日

发表回复

登录后才能评论